Lorraine Lord-Saylor 68, of Fort Wayne died Sunday in Lutheran Hospital.
The Arlington, N.J., native was a member of Trinity Episcopal Church, PEO, Fort Wayne Junior League and Psi Iote sorority, co-founder of the Tulip Tree Gift Shop of Foellinger-Freimann Botanical Conservatory and former Junior League Sustainer of the Year.
Surviving are a daughter, Susan F. Saylor of Lakewood, Ohio; a son, Daniel L. of Raleigh, N.C.; and a brother, Alan C. Lord of Fort Wayne.
Services are 4 p.m. tomorrow in the church. Calling is 7 to 9 p.m. today in Klaehn, Fahl & Melton Funeral Homes, Wayne Street Chapel, 420 W. Wayne St. Burial will be in Delaware Cemetery, Dingman's Ferry, Pa.
Preferred memorials are gifts to St. Jude Children's Research Hospital, Memphis, Tenn.
